ST. AGNES' SEMINARY
Union street, near Court Brooklyn Standard Union 14 May 1909 The annual commencement exercises of St. Agnes' Seminary, Union street, near Court, was held last evening in the parish hall of St. Agnes' Church, Degraw street near Hoyt. Each of the young women received, besides a diploma, a medal and laurel wreath from the hands of Monsignor DUFFY, and at the end of the excersises a wreath of floral offerings from their friends. The graduates: Eleanor Marie BLEAKNEY, Anna Gertrude BRANIGAN, Camilla Marie CLARK, Eva Regina FEENAN, Catherine Raphael GILLESPIE, Florence Gertryde KIERNAN, Sadie Adelaide KENNY, Irene Frances LYNCH, Catherine Marie MUNZ, Julia Agnes MCNAMARA, Anna Magdalen MACTAGUE, Catherine Philomena NEWMAN, Mary Geraldine O'BRIEN, Maud Marie STRUMPFLER, Florence Marie STACK, Daisy Elizabeth WARD, Anna Marie WHALEN Agnes Bernaddetta WATERS.
